Improving at climbing isn’t just about strength and body conditioning – your head game plays a huge part too! Big Rock Bond is pleased to host Kevin Roet from CLIMB IN FLOW who will be running two workshops focusing on climbing psychology.

The workshops on offer, FEAR of FALLING and HOW TO TRY HARD IN CLIMBING, last around 5 hours and include a combination of theory and practical. These workshops will teach you strategies to deal with anxiety, develop focus, and improve your climbing performance.

In our fear of falling workshop we look at what happens in the brain when fear kicks in. We look at ways to deal with this fear, and how we can progressively manage this, to try and improve our climbing. The workshop lasts around 6 hours and includes a combination of theory and practical.

By the end of the fear of falling workshop, you will have learnt more about yourself, and grown in confidence in your own ability.  And have an array of strategies to take away, and progress further in your climbing.
